Vue2项目实战:就业加强版源码设计与实现

版权申诉
0 下载量 7 浏览量 更新于2024-11-02 收藏 1.05MB ZIP 举报
资源摘要信息:"基于Vue的就业加强vue2项目设计源码" 一、Vue框架基础 Vue.js是一个构建用户界面的渐进式框架,专注于视图层。Vue的设计思想是采用简单的数据绑定和组件化思想,使得开发者能够更加轻松地构建单页应用。Vue的核心库只关注视图层,它不仅易于上手,而且能够轻松与第三方库或既有项目整合。该项目使用了Vue.js框架的2.x版本,这也是Vue.js最为广泛使用和稳定的一个版本。 二、项目结构与组成 该Vue项目包含了大量的HTML文件、Vue文件以及其他支持性配置文件,共计110个文件。其中,HTML文件用于定义网页的结构,Vue文件则是核心的单文件组件(Single File Components,SFC),它们将模板、脚本和样式封装在同一个文件中。29个Vue文件中包含了组件的逻辑和模板,而49个HTML文件则可能包括了项目中的各种页面。 三、前端技术堆栈 - HTML:定义网页内容的结构。 - Vue.js:构建用户界面的渐进式JavaScript框架。 - JavaScript:编写动态网页的脚本语言。 - CSS:描述网页的样式。 四、项目构建与开发工具 为了提升开发效率和项目的质量,项目中还包含了以下重要配置文件和工具: - .browserslistrc:用于指定项目的目标浏览器环境。 - .editorconfig:定义代码风格,帮助开发者使用不同的编辑器时保持统一的编码风格。 - .gitignore:指定Git版本控制中要忽略的文件和文件夹,以避免将编译后的文件、日志文件等提交到版本库。 - .eslintrc.js:配置ESLint代码检查规则。 - jest.config.js:配置Jest测试框架的配置文件,Jest是Facebook开源的一个用于JavaScript的测试框架,常用于前端项目的单元测试。 - babel.config.js:配置Babel转译器,Babel用于将使用了ES6+特性的代码转换为向后兼容的JavaScript代码。 - package.json:列出项目中所依赖的npm包和项目的元数据。 - yarn.lock:与package.json配合使用,确保项目依赖的一致性和确定性。 五、项目文件夹结构 项目中的src文件夹是源代码的主要存放位置,通常包含了项目的源文件,包括JavaScript、Vue、CSS、HTML等。在项目的构建过程中,这个文件夹下的文件会被转换、打包、压缩成最终部署到服务器上的代码。 六、用户体验和项目功能 项目的目标是为用户提供全面、便捷的vue2项目解决方案,通过高效的前端技术结合,提升用户体验。用户在使用该就业加强vue2项目时,能够享受到高效的应用加载、流畅的交互动效和良好的用户界面设计,从而提高工作效率,加速就业过程。 七、项目实践意义 该Vue项目为前端开发者提供了一个实践平台,通过学习和分析项目源码,开发者可以深入理解Vue框架及其生态系统。此外,该项目也适合作为就业准备的个人项目,帮助求职者在前端开发领域展示自己的能力和技术深度。通过项目的实战演练,开发者可以掌握如何构建和维护复杂度较高的前端项目,为未来的就业竞争增添筹码。